Transaction 576747e48d8b6750ae20b6751271e548deab6043992126aa8770f345647489f3

1 Input
1 Outputs
  • 576747e48d8b6750ae20b6751271e548deab6043992126aa8770f345647489f3:0
  • value  11054566
    address  19KpaZCW8fhUjxM4L7U5XTo8MB1DmyWS1S